Description

10 Euros from Federal Republic of Germany. Issued in 2011. Struck in Silver (.625). Measures 32.5 mm and weighs 16 g.

Obverse
The stylized federal eagle surrounded by the twelve stars of the European Union in the center of the coin. Around the eagle the name of the state "BUNDESREPUBLIK DEUTSCHLAND", the Federal Republic of Germany, the year "2011", the mintmark by a letter "A" "D" "F" "G" or "J" and the face value "10 EURO". Under the eagle the mention "Silber 625", silver 625‰, to avoid any confusion with the coin struck in cupronickel.
Reverse
A player and a ball in front of a globe surrounded by the inscription "FRAUENFUSSBALL - WM IN DEUTSCHLAND".
Edge
Inscripted (The Future of Football is Female)
